What is the Hydraulic Coupling?

1. Operating Principle

A hydraulic coupling is a device that uses hydraulic fluid to transmit power between two shafts, allowing for smooth power transfer without direct physical contact.

2. Components

It consists of an impeller, runner, and working chamber filled with hydraulic fluid, creating a torque converter that enables power transmission.

3. Functionality

The coupling allows for variable speed control and torque multiplication, making it ideal for heavy machinery that requires precise power management.

4. Applications

Hydraulic couplings are commonly used in industries such as mining, construction, and manufacturing to drive equipment like crushers, conveyors, and pumps.

5. Benefits

They offer smooth starting, overload protection, and vibration dampening, enhancing the performance and longevity of machinery.

How Does a Hydraulic Coupler Work?

  1. Hydraulic fluid is used to transfer power between the input and output shafts.
  2. The impeller accelerates the fluid, transmitting torque to the driven equipment.
  3. Variable speed control is achieved by adjusting the fluid flow within the coupling.
  4. Overload protection is provided by allowing for slip during sudden load changes.
  5. Vibration dampening reduces noise and enhances operator comfort during operation.
